Joshua Flint’s painting “Synchrony” invites us into a world where human emotion and the natural world intersect. Here, a woman adorned with a crown of flowers covers her eyes as hummingbirds flutter around her. Flint’s work often explores themes of identity, memory, and the search for meaning in a complex world. In this piece, the woman's gesture suggests vulnerability or introspection, while the hummingbirds—symbols of joy and adaptability—create a sense of dynamic energy. Is this joy or burden? The birds appear to hover above her, suggesting an alternative narrative that offers a sense of freedom. The title, “Synchrony,” hints at a deeper connection between the woman and her environment. The woman's face is hidden from the viewer, inviting a sense of introspection. Perhaps this piece is more an exploration of the complex internal state of the artist, a mirror of our own search for solace and connection amidst life’s challenges.
